We’ll start with one of the simplest bread making recipes; a 2 pound white bread. The aim is to get the basics right before we move on to the more advanced loafs.
Step 1: Get the ingredients ready;

- Water 1 1/3 cups
- Oil (I use Canola & Sunflower Oil) 3 Tablespoons
- Sugar (I prefer brown sugar) 2 Tablespoons
- Salt 1 Teaspoon
- Milk powder 2 Tablespoons
- High protein flour 4 1/3 cups
- Active dry yeast 1 ½ Teaspoon
